Oracle Application Development Framework (ADF) is a Java EE framework that simplifies building enterprise Java applications. It provides a visual and declarative approach to Java development through drag-and-drop data binding, visual UI design, and reusable business components. It is commonly used for building web, mobile, and desktop applications that interact with databases.
